Dr. Armando Soto's response
I'm sorry anyone was not pleased with their experience. On the other hand, it is difficult to feel responsible for this, given the extensive efforts we make to help patients avoid wasting their time (or ours).

Every single time a patient contacts my office, whether by phone or email, they are informed that if their body mass index (the standard for determining obesity and safety in medicine) is above 30, they will not be considered a candidate for elective surgery and that a consultation would be a waste of their time and money. In almost all cases, patients who need to lose weight before considering their desired body improvements are very appreciative and call us back when they have achieved a BMI below 30 (as recommended by our professional associations for the safe performance of elective cosmetic surgery). Thankfully it is rare- but we do occasionally have someone be dishonest with our staff about their current weight in order to get on my schedule. When this happens, we do have to explain at their consultation that they are not a safe candidate for surgery and offer helpful tips or assistance with weight loss. Our goal is, and has always been, to provide all of our patients with the very best outcomes possible, in the very safest manner possible. This means the patient sometimes has to participate in the preparation for surgery by losing weight. And while I will remain committed to maintaining these very high standards of safety in my own practice, it is true that not all other offices do. They are recommendations- not requirements. Further, these are not facts (a patient's weight or BMI, or the effect of obesity on the safety of elective surgery) which would be materially affected by performing any particular examination technique. So- if this is from a real patient, I am sorry if anyone was not pleased... But please know that with a BMI of 30 or greater, patients are definitely taking more risks with their safety and lowering their chances of being happy with their outcome. It is always best to be honest in all communications with doctors and their office staff.
